I would do the Lincoln MKX over the Accord coupe based solely on practicality. For me, the size of the vehicle is an issue. If you have a child, or if you ever have to move or cart around any kind of object that is large in size, you'll thank yourself for buying the SUV. I have driven both and love he accord coupe but Honda still hasnt created a sport coupe, just a sporty appliance. The MKX is the Ford Edge but more dressier. At the end of the day there is no winning, there is just settling for which better suits your lifestyle.
